Two dead, four missing in Spanish mine accident

At least two miners died on Monday and four were missing in an accident in a mine in the northern Spanish region of Asturias, the regional emergency service said.

The emergency service said another three people had been injured due to a machine malfunction inside the mine in Degana at 9:32 a.m. (0732 GMT) local time. Three helicopters and two ambulances have been sent to the scene.

El Mundo newspaper said earlier there had been an explosion in the mine and that several people were trapped.
